Prerequisite Performance

Prerequisite courses must be successfully completed with a grade of C or better. In plus-minus grading systems, a grade of C- does not qualify as a C. Applicants offered seats contingent upon successful completion of outstanding prerequisites must complete each remaining course with a grade of B or better (earning a grade of B- does not qualify as a B).

Prerequisite Timeline Requirements

To be considered for the RMU speech-language pathology program, each prerequisite course must have been completed within ten years of the cohort start date. Additionally, credits must have been earned from a regionally accredited institution and be verifiable through official transcripts.

Required Bachelor Degree

Applicants must demonstrate completion of a bachelor’s degree or higher from an accredited institution prior to matriculation into the speech-language pathology program.

Vaccination Requirements

Admitted students of the MS MedSLP program will receive vaccination forms regarding required vaccinations. Documentation is required for all vaccinations before starting the program. The University allows for vaccination exemptions and more information about the University’s position on vaccination can be reviewed at https://rm.edu/vaccination-statement/.   The MS MedSLP program requires the following vaccinations and testing (these are subject to change depending on public health concerns):
  • Hepatitis B series and/or titer (Booster or additional series may be required if immunity not achieved)
  • T-dap or qualified waiver-current within the last 10 years (if this expires during the program you must get a new one)
  • 2 MMR (Measles, Mumps, Rubella) (only 1, if born before 1957)
  • 2 separate TB skin tests or negative chest radiograph (current for each year)
  • Varicella Zoster titer or history of disease documented by health care professional (vaccine may be required if immunity not achieved)
  • Current Year Influenza Shot
  • Covid-19 Vaccination

Program Accreditation

The Master of Science program in Speech-Language Pathology (MS-SLP) residential education program in speech-language pathology, at Rocky Mountain University of Health Professions, is accredited by the Council on Academic Accreditation in Audiology and Speech-Language Pathology of the American Speech-Language-Hearing Association, 2200 Research Boulevard, #310, Rockville, MD 20850, 800-498-2071 or 301-296-5700
